Blockchain technology is one of the most trending technologies these days and is used for more than just economic transactions. Blockchain tech can transform the traditional ways to do business and transact with each other. The term Digital transformation perfectly blends into the definition of blockchain.
Blockchain represents the decentralized network essential these days, and companies do not want to let this go. Businesses seek a top mobile app development company with several years of experience in building the blockchain app according to their needs. But the question is: how much does it cost to build a blockchain-based app platform?
Platform
The cost to develop a blockchain-based app depends on multiple factors, including app features, blockchain type, complexity, a blockchain platform, and other tech stacks. Considering numerous factors, examples, & numbers, we have evaluated the cost of blockchain-based app platforms.
In this blog, we will look at the various factors that should be considered to estimate a blockchain app’s cost.
– Process or Phrases
– Complexity
– Development Resources
We will look into each one by one. Let’s begin!
Cost Determination of Blockchain-based App
1. Process / Phrases

Cost of blockchain implementation is invested in various activities or phrases of the project, including:
– Design: System Blueprint, UI/UI design including wireframes, low-fidelity designs with app flow & high-fidelity designs with a mock-up.
– Development: Coding & Testing
– Deployment: Deployment on DevOps, Cloud Platforms, and Delivery
– Migration: Moving the current solution to the Blockchain platform
– Maintenance: Maintaining new updates & testing if the app runs seamlessly on each OS release.
– Upgrade: New features, Modifications in Smart Contracts
– 3-rd Party Tools: Hosting, Storage, Collaboration, Notification System
Blockchain-based platforms also incur other costs, such as a developer paying some fee to deploy a contract on the blockchain.
Below are a few third-party tools that blockchain apps might use:
– Bug tracking tools like Instabug & Bugsee: Collecting and reporting live bugs
– Amazon web services: Computing, storage, and delivery
– Analytics with Mixpanel: Analytics of funnel, insights, data, and reporting
– Notification services like AmazonSNS: facilitating notifications inside the app
Project Management Cost
For instance, applying an agile method to execute frequent meetings or daily scrums, track the existing sprint, testing, bugs, timeline, and deliverables. And using tools like Jira and Trello to enable the agile technique. The cost of using such tools can also contribute to the cost of blockchain. For example, using the Jira tool to deliver action items to customers & track the internal team’s progress.
Continuous Integration
It is essential to preserve a pipeline of quality code. Every developer must write code and conform to a standard code depository to ensure that it works seamlessly with everyone else’s code. The correct way to check this is by using an automated process. The source code can be handled with tools like Github and Bitbucket. These tools also contribute to the blockchain-app cost.
Maintenance
Since this tech is still new in the market, and new platforms are entering the market each day, the apps can be converted to different platforms based on their flexibility, scalability, and confidentiality. Moreover, every year Google, Apple, and various blockchain platforms release new OS updates. This calls for a maintenance cost of 15-20% of the overall project cost, and it could differ based on the complexity.
2. Complexity
The cost of blockchain depends on the complexity of your app, and the complexity depends on multiple factors.
We have segregated the blockchain app into 3 categories based on their complexity:
Low-Complexity Blockchain Apps
– Basic Smart Contract Development App
– Payment apps developed with current cryptocurrencies
Medium-Complexity Blockchain Apps
– Semi-decentralized apps
– dApps developed on blockchain platforms such as Hyperledger, EOS, Ethereum, Fabric/Sawtooth, and more
High-Complexity Blockchain Apps
– Developing a blockchain platform from the start
– Creating an entire decentralized network
3. Development Resources

The cost of recruiting a team for app development is a significant contribution to the estimated cost. Salaries to the software developers are the main expense, but other imp factors include vacations, incentive compensation, benefits, holidays, and payroll taxes.
There are several ways to develop a blockchain app, and some of them are as follows:
– Developing a blockchain-based app with an in-house team
– Recruiting a freelancer for a blockchain-based app platform
– Recruiting an agency to develop a blockchain-based app
In-House Team
Maintaining an in-house team of blockchain developers seems complicated only cuz’ of monetary factors. However, digging deeper, you will know there are plenty of issues. Although, you will have a dedicated team who will be on their toes if any problems arise. You will have complete control over your blockchain development and manage the team’s expenses, including their incentives, vacations, workspace, and more.
Since blockchain is still nascent, there is a lack of experienced developers in the market. The average pay of a blockchain developer is $150k annually. It can be more expensive to recruit an in-house team than outsourcing a blockchain development company.
Freelancers
Hiring freelancers can be the least costly for blockchain app development; however, 80% of businesses face problems like their availability, quality, response time, and more. You can recruit a freelancer if your project is small because the risk factor rises with the project scope.
Agency
Any blockchain specialized agency can be the best option. Agencies serve as a full-time service provider and are experienced in the app development practices like Agile & DevOps. The cost of a blockchain app is lower than the in-house team. Sign a contract before starting to work on your project, which includes deliverables with particular timelines. Hence, you can count on them for your core business competencies.

Design In a world of continuous change and innovation, design trends emerge rapidly—along with new operating systems and devices. Although many trends come and go quickly, some have managed to stick around for the past few years. Today’s mobile design trends are breaking ground, influenced by technology, art, and culture.

Design

Mobile UX & UI have never played a more important role than they do today, for large and small firms alike. For larger companies, mobile application design plays an essential role. As a part of a “mobile-first” strategy; companies aim to develop unique, mobile applications that deliver quality results to users.

Related:-Impact Of Technology On Modern Land Surveying Techniques

After analyzing the latest trends in mobile application design, we picked out the eight most relevant.

  1. Smooth User Interface: User Interface (UI) should be one of the first things you consider when designing a mobile app. The more functional and flexible your app is, the better it is for users. Users today want a seamless design that enables them to use apps without any effort or confusion.
  1. Functional Animation: Functional animation is subtle animation embedded in a UI design as part of the functionality of that design. Users enjoy it because it brings new levels of excitement when using an app. Animation should always serve a purpose and shouldn’t be used merely for aesthetics. There must also be a balance between form and function—animations shouldn’t do all the work. Functional animation is a great tool that can make your app stand out from competitors.
  1. Bigger Screen Designs: The new generation has embraced larger smartphones and tablets. These large devices bring new challenges to designers that traditionally created interfaces for small devices. Larger screens change the way users hold devices, so it’s important to consider this when designing an app.For instance, some designers choose to concentrate all controls at the bottom of the screen. This way, users can use just one thumb without having to engage the other hand.
  1. Card Layouts, Swipe Navigation: The card layout trend began in 2014 and is still going strong. Users enjoy the card layout because it allows you to group information in outlined boxes—making them an entry point to more detailed information.  In addition, swipe is the most natural gesture these days. Users love the ease of swiping through stacks of cards to navigate through an app.
  1. Unique Navigation: Another trend among designers is making navigation unique, without giving up intuitiveness. Today, users have the option to choose the type of navigation they want to use in an app. Unique navigation improves UI by giving users the freedom to navigate vertically, horizontally, or even in a modular manner.
  1. Overlays: More and more users today are using overlays. Overlays move users out of the application’s normal flow in seconds. It’s important to ensure that overlays don’t get in the way of the app’s functionality. They shouldn’t include too much detail; mobile app users don’t want to spend too much time learning how to use the app. When used appropriately, users become more engaged and interested in using your app.
  1. Typography: Using the right font helps to differentiate between headlines and paragraphs. Designers today are challenged with implementing typography that is scalable, ensuring that apps fit every device regardless of the screen size. Whether using an iPad or wearing an Apple Watch, users appreciate being able to use the same apps.
  1. Fresh Color Schemes: Traditional flat design made white backgrounds a trend. Today, more designers are using vibrant color schemes within their applications. Designers continue to experiment with light and dark palettes, depending on whether their users use their app during the day or at night.

User Interface design hasn’t changed much since last year. Overall, we are beginning to see simpler interfaces that aim to make users’ experiences as seamless as possible. Intuitive UI is critical to the success of your app. If you’re looking to design a new app or update an existing one, incorporating one or a combination of these trends will set you apart from your competition.